If your dog will not stop biting, it can prove very frustrating. A dog who bites can become a big problem and liability. It is not just those big dogs that bite, those little dogs are not as innocent as you think. No matter what, whether your dog is big or small, it is a good idea to learn some techniques to stop a dog biting. When you have a puppy, you will find that part of his or her nature is to nip. Puppies may nip at you gently as they are playing and it may be cute, but if you do not stop it when they are little, there will be bigger issues when they are full grown. If you don't train your puppy you may end up with a misunderstood adult dog. It isn't the dogs fault if they have developed thinking that biting is a game.In order to stop a dog biting it is best to start early but you can still teach an old dog new tricks, it just might take longer. There are a few methods to try to stop a dog biting. First of all, pay attention to the communication. Do you know that communication is a very important aspect in training a dog? When you are playing with your puppy or dog, when they start to nip at you, you will need to communicate to them that it is hurting you. You should not yell at them. Instead, the next time they are nipping at you, say "ouch" and let out a loud yelp. When you yelp, they will understand that it is painful and this will discourage your dog from biting you, because they do not want to hurt you. A high pitched "ouch" would actually do the job. When you decide to use this technique, you should stop playing with them right away and turn your back on them. When it comes to that dog, body language and tone are both important. Divert the attention - This is another way to stop your dog from biting. When he or she is nipping at you, try diverting their attention to something that they are allowed to chew on, such as a chew toy. You need to make sure you have that toy or chew available at all times so that you can quickly divert your dogs attention. After a while, they will learn that biting your skin is not something that they are supposed to do.They will find the toy much more rewarding!
